The Assistant Director of Operations is a developmental multi-unit leadership role designed for a high-performing General Manager ready to step into broader operational oversight. This is an opportunity for a motivated, humble, and coachable leader who is eager to grow into senior-level operations.
This role supports the Director of Operations in executing company strategy, driving operational consistency, developing General Managers, and ensuring hospitality excellence across multiple locations.
The ideal candidate is hungry for growth, thrives on feedback, and is comfortable executing an established leadership vision within a structured organization.
Key Responsibilities Operational Execution- Support oversight of multiple restaurant locations, ensuring consistent execution of systems and standards.
- Partner with General Managers to improve performance, guest experience, and team engagement.
- Execute operational initiatives with discipline and attention to detail.
- Ensure alignment with established leadership direction and company objectives.
- Coach and support General Managers in leadership, accountability, and hospitality standards.
- Identify talent gaps and assist in building a strong leadership bench.
- Embrace ongoing feedback from senior leadership and model a growth mindset.
- Monitor key performance indicators including sales, labor, food cost, and operational standards.
- Assist in driving profitability while protecting culture and guest experience.
- Participate in structured performance reviews and operational audits.
- Champion a hospitality-first mindset across all teams.
- Reinforce company values through presence, communication, and consistency.
- Help maintain a culture built on humility, accountability, and continuous improvement.
